Located close to town, this three-story home has lots to offer! From the off-street parking area, stairs lead up to the first level, which features a bedroom, full bathroom, laundry hookups, and a spacious game room. The second level serves as the main living area and includes a bright kitchen, bathroom, mudroom, and a bonus room. Large windows, skylights, and a wood-burning stove create a warm, inviting atmosphere. On the third floor, you’ll find the primary bedroom complete with a toilet, sink, and a beautiful window that brings in plenty of natural light. Outside, enjoy a large fenced-in backyard and a convenient storage shed — perfect for extra space or outdoor projects.
